Programme structures

The programme aims to provide students with the necessary skills and attributes to enable them to be effective laboratory managers.

The programme is delivered by online distance learning over three years [via state-of-the-art virtual learning environment (VLE)], with emphasis on the fundamental principles and governance which underpin contemporary laboratory management practice as well as leadership and management skills.

In year 1, students will undertake a total of 30 credits in key central business discipline areas in ASBS along with a total of 30 credits in MVLS, where they will cover laboratory health and safety and key themes relating to laboratory practice, governance and ethics.

In year 2, students will build upon studies in year 1 by undertaking a further 30 credits in key central business discipline areas in ASBS and 30 credits in MVLS, where they will cover principles of providing training and supervision in the laboratory and fundamentals of laboratory management.

In year 3, MSc/PGDip students will complete a dissertation relating to an independent project in a relevant topic of their choice.

Defined exit points

  • PgCert (60 credits, year 1 courses)
  • PgDip (120 credits, years 1 & 2 courses)
  • MSc (180 credits, years 1 & 2 courses plus dissertation - three years in total).
